NVIDIA, CGSociety Announces 3rd NVArt Contest Winners

SANTA CLARA, CA, Aug 26, 2008 - NVISION 08 - NVIDIA and CGSociety today announced the winners of the third NVArt digital art competition. The theme was "Digital Fusion." Artists from around the world were invited to submit computer-generated imagery of "awe-inspiring fusions" of 2D and 3D designs.

"In this competition we asked the entrants to create inspiring design fusions that were more than the sum of their 2D and 3D parts - designs that leap from the page and into 3D on their way into our imaginations," said Mark Snoswell, president of CGSociety, a global organization for digital artists. "Whether rendered flat as 2D or sculpted as 3D, great design distinguishes itself as something special that is far more than the sum of its parts."

Selected NVArt award winners will be on display at NVISION 08, an event for visual computing professionals and enthusiasts, on August 25-27, 2008 in San Jose, California. NVArt submissions have been showcased recently at the San Jose Museum of Art in Silicon Valley and the Tate Modern in London.

Award Winners

The winners of the "Digital Fusion" competition are:

  • 1st place: Fusion by Heiko Klug

  • 2nd place: Cock and the centipede by Jason Lynch

  • 3rd place: When Tialli calls you by Carlos Ortega Elizalde

Honorable Mention:

  • The Body Art by Alvin Tea

  • Dfusion 2 by Deepak Hargaonkar

  • Urban Movement by Pedro G. C. Jafet

Judging

The submissions were reviewed by a distinguished panel of judges, including: Pascal Blanche, Ubisoft; Lorne Lanning, Oddworld Inhabitants; Stephan Martinere, Midway Games; Steven Stahlberg, Androidblues; Mark Snoswell, CGSociety; and David Wright, NVIDIA.

About CGSociety

CGSociety is a respected and accessible global organization for creative digital artists. CGSociety supports artists at every level by offering a range of services to connect, inform, educate, and promote, by celebrating achievement, excellence, and innovation in all aspects of digital art. CGSociety, along with Ballistic Publishing, is a division of Ballistic Media. For more information, visit http://www.cgsociety.org and http://www.BallisticPublishing.com.

About NVIDIA Corporation

NVIDIA (Nasdaq: NVDA) is the world leader in visual computing technologies and the inventor of the GPU, a high-performance processor which generates breathtaking, interactive graphics on workstations, personal computers, game consoles, and mobile devices. NVIDIA serves the entertainment and consumer market with its GeForce products, the professional design and visualization market with its Quadro products, and the high-performance computing market with its Tesla products. NVIDIA is headquartered in Santa Clara, Calif. and has offices throughout Asia, Europe, and the Americas.
